Benjamin Deschamps is one of the young lions of Montreal Jazz. He’s a multi instrumentalist, playing flute, clarinet and all of the Sax’s.

 

Very active on the Montreal music scene, he created  the “Atomic Big Band” in 2010 which features the new generation  of elite  jazz musicians in  Montreal. He also directed the Montreal All City Big Band during the 2012 winter session, the same year that he he received his Bachelor in jazz interpretation. He’s performed in France with the McGill Jazz Orchestra and in 2013, he joined Jacques Kuba Séguin’s group “The Odd Lot” for a tour in Poland.

The Benjamin Deschamps Quartet came together in 2013. The band won the Rimouski Festi Jazz Grand Prix that year.  In March 2014, The quartet  launched his first recording  “What Do We Know?” with Montreal’s label Oddsound.
